Add 63/4 and 54/3
1st number: 15 3/4, 2nd number: 18 0/3
63/4 + 54/3 is 135/4.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 3 is 12
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 12 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 3 = 12,
63/4 = 63 × 3/4 × 3 = 189/12 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 3 × 4 = 12,
54/3 = 54 × 4/3 × 4 = 216/12 - Add the two like fractions:
189/12 + 216/12 = 189 + 216/12 = 405/12 - 405/12 simplified gives 135/4
- So, 63/4 + 54/3 = 135/4
